- 2
- 0
- 约4.94万字
- 约 67页
- 2019-01-09 发布于上海
- 举报
基于fpga的多通道dma控制器的ip核设计-通信与信息系统专业论文
华北电力大学硕士学位论文摘
华北电力大学硕士学位论文
摘 要
当前,随着电子技术的飞速发展,智能化系统中需要传输的数据量日益增大, 要求数据传送的速度也越来越快,传统的数据传输方式已无法满足目前的要求。在 此前提下,采用高速数据传输技术成为必然,DMA(直接存储器访问)技术就是较
理想的解决方案之一,能够满足信息处理实时性和准确性的要求。
本文以EDA工具、硬件描述语言和可编程逻辑器件(FPGA)为技术支撑,设计 DMA控制器的总体结构。在通道检测模块中,解决了信号抗干扰和请求信号撤销问 题,并提出并行通道检测算法;在优先级管理模块中提出了动态优先级端口响应机 制;在传输模块中采用状态机的设计思想设计多个通道的数据传输。通过各模块问
题的解决及新方法的采用,最终设计出基于FPGA的多通道DMA控制器的IP软核。
实验仿真结果表明,本控制器传输速度较快,主频达IOOMHz以上,且工作稳定。
关键词:直接存储器访问,IP核,EDA工具,硬件描述语言,FPGA
ABSTR ACT
At present,with the rapid development of electronic technology,the intelligent systems require increasing amount and growing fast of data transmission.The traditional transmission methods have been unable to meet current demands.Base on these reasons, it is necessary to adopt the high-speed data transmission technology.DMA(Direct
Memory Access)technology is one of the best solutions which could meet the
requirements of real.time and accuracy for information processing.
Depending on EDA tools,hardware description language and programmable logic devices(FPGA),the paper develops the whole frame for DMA controller.It resolves signal anti-jamming and request signal revocation and proposes parallel channel test method in channel test module,as well as proposes dynamic priority response method in priority management module and adopts state machine to design data transmission for multi—channel in transmission module.Through resolving the problems in each module and adopting new methods,finally,the IP core is developed for multi·channel DMA controller on FPGA.The simulations show that the controller works fast and the clock can reach beyond 1 00MHz.At the same time.it runs well in actual operation.
(Communication and Information System)
Directed by prof.Tang Liangrui
instructor Gao Xuelian KEY WORDS:Direct Memory Access,IP core,EDA tools,Hardware Description
Language,FPGA
华北电力大学硕士学位论文摘
华北电力大学硕士学位论文
摘 要
当前,随着电子技术的飞速发展,智能化系统中需要传输的数据量日益增大, 要求数据传送的速度也越来越快,传统的数据传输方式已无法满足目前的要求。在 此前提下,采用高速数据传输技术成为必然,DMA(直接存储器访问)技术就是较
理想的解决方案之一,能够满足信息处理实时性和准确性的要求。
您可能关注的文档
- 基于arm主控芯片的微型热敏打印驱动及系统设计-光学工程专业论文.docx
- 基于8086单芯片计算机bios软件的设计与实现-微电子学与固体电子学专业论文.docx
- 基于arm的压电薄膜轴的车辆动态称重系统嵌入式研究与设计-模式识别与智能系统专业论文.docx
- 基于.net的某加工企业生产管理系统设计与实现-软件工程专业论文.docx
- 基于fpga的非线性调频信号脉冲压缩的实现-电子与通信工程专业论文.docx
- 基于fpga的音乐景观灯的设计与实现-计算机软件与理论专业论文.docx
- 基于canopen的混合动力汽车车载故障诊断系统的分析与实现-控制理论与控制工程专业论文.docx
- 基于can总线的大功率整流控制器的研究与设计-控制科学与工程专业论文.docx
- 基于ct图像的活体人颅骨几何特征测量与研究-测试计量技术及仪器专业论文.docx
- 基于adp的在线学习算法及其在热轧活套中的应用研究-电力电子与电力传动专业论文.docx
- 安徽省华师联盟2025-2026学年高三上学期1月质量检测生物试卷+答案.doc
- 安徽省华师联盟2025-2026学年高三上学期1月质量检测语文试卷+答案.doc
- 四川省绵阳南山中学实验学校2025-2026学年高三上学期1月月考数学含答案.doc
- 2026届辽宁省大连市高三上学期双基考试物理试卷+答案.doc
- 辽宁名校联盟2026年1月高三上期末联考质量检测化学含答案.doc
- 辽宁名校联盟2026年1月高三上期末联考质量检测生物含答案.doc
- 辽宁名校联盟2026年1月高三上期末联考质量检测英语含答案.doc
- 辽宁名校联盟2026年1月高三上期末联考质量检测政治含答案.doc
- 黑龙江省龙江教育联盟2026年1月高三上学期期末考试化学含答案.doc
- 黑龙江省龙江教育联盟2026年1月高三上学期期末考试生物含答案.doc
最近下载
- 2025年阿勒泰地区遴选公务员笔试真题汇编及答案解析(夺冠).docx VIP
- GB55006-2021 钢结构通用规范.pdf VIP
- 精品解析:2023-2024学年江苏省南京市江北新区译林版(三起)三年级上册期末考试英语试卷(原卷版).docx VIP
- 动漫制作合同范本.docx VIP
- CCY-I-产品使用手册(带MEP).pdf VIP
- 湖南省怀化市2024-2025学年高一上学期期末考试英语试题含答案.pdf VIP
- 23G409先张法预应力混凝土管桩图集.PDF VIP
- 人民大2024Premiere视频剪辑技术 PPT课件项目1 揭开pr的神秘面纱.pptx VIP
- 2025年开心果行业研究报告及未来发展趋势预测.docx
- 【专业资料】ALD原子层沉积综述PPT.pptx VIP
原创力文档

文档评论(0)